What county is Aberystwyth in?
Ceredigion county
Aberystwyth, coastal town, Ceredigion county, historic county of Cardiganshire, western Wales. It is situated where the River Rheidol flows into Cardigan Bay.

Are postcodes unique to each house?
Each postcode covers an average of about 15 properties. However, this is not a definitive number, where postcodes can hold up to 100.

What does aber mean in Welsh?
mouth of
As a result many of the towns in Wales begin with the prefix Aber which means “mouth of” – Aberystwyth meaning the mouth of the River Ystwyth, Abergele the mouth of the River Gele and so on. Places like Porthcawl have a rather special meaning – harbour with sea kale.

What area is sp?
These cover south Wiltshire (including Salisbury and Tidworth) and parts of north Dorset (including Gillingham and Shaftesbury) and west Hampshire (including Andover and Fordingbridge). The letters in the postcode refer to the Salisbury Plain, a plateau within the postcode area.

What do the first 2 letters of a postcode mean?
The first part of the Postcode eg PO1 is called the outward code as it identifies the town or district to which the letter is to be sent for further sorting. The second part of the postcode eg 1EB is called the inward code.
